How to Mine Blockchain
Blockchain mining is the process of adding new transactions to the blockchain, a distributed ledger that records transactions across many computers. Miners verify new transactions and add them to the blockchain, receiving a reward in the form of cryptocurrency for their work.
Steps on How to Mine Blockchain:
1. Choose a Cryptocurrency:
- Different cryptocurrencies have different mining algorithms. Choose a cryptocurrency that matches the hardware you have available.
2. Acquire Mining Hardware:
- Specialized hardware is required for mining blockchain. You can either purchase ASICs (Application-Specific Integrated Circuits) or use graphics cards (GPUs).
3. Join a Mining Pool:
- Joining a mining pool increases your chances of finding a block and earning a reward. Mining pools combine the computing power of multiple miners.
4. Install Mining Software:
- Specialized mining software, such as CGMiner or BFGminer, is required to connect to a mining pool and broadcast blocks.
5. Configure Mining Hardware:
- Properly configure your mining hardware (ASICs or GPUs) by adjusting settings such as clock speeds, fan speeds, and power consumption.
6. Start Mining:
- Connect your mining hardware to a mining pool and start the mining software. The hardware will begin processing transactions and searching for blocks.
7. Monitor Your Mining:
- Use mining monitoring software to track your progress, monitor your hardware's performance, and adjust settings as needed.
Rewards and Considerations:
Rewards:
- Miners earn a reward in cryptocurrency for successfully adding a block to the blockchain. The reward typically includes a fixed amount of cryptocurrency and transaction fees associated with the block.
Considerations:
- High Energy Consumption: Mining can consume a significant amount of electricity.
- Difficulty: The difficulty of mining increases as more miners join the network.
- Competition: Mining can be competitive, making it difficult to find a block without joining a mining pool.
- Profitability: Mining profitability depends on factors such as cryptocurrency value, energy costs, and hardware efficiency.
